A growing Insolvency Practice in Birmingham is seeking an experienced Insolvency Cashier to join their team. The company has experienced an increase in work, and they are looking to expand their cashiering function to keep up with demand.

As an Insolvency Cashier, you will be responsible for:

  • Opening and closing of bank accounts
  • Banking, recording and analysis of receipts
  • Processing payments manually and electronically
  • Performing bank account reconciliations to required deadlines
  • Preparation and filing of Statutory Returns and VAT returns
  • Journal raising and posting Corporation tax calculations and corresponding with HM Revenue & Customs
